| 1 | /* |
| 2 | * include/linux/node.h - generic node definition |
| 3 | * |
| 4 | * This is mainly for topological representation. We define the |
| 5 | * basic 'struct node' here, which can be embedded in per-arch |
| 6 | * definitions of processors. |
| 7 | * |
| 8 | * Basic handling of the devices is done in drivers/base/node.c |
| 9 | * and system devices are handled in drivers/base/sys.c. |
| 10 | * |
| 11 | * Nodes are exported via driverfs in the class/node/devices/ |
| 12 | * directory. |
| 13 | * |
| 14 | * Per-node interfaces can be implemented using a struct device_interface. |
| 15 | * See the following for how to do this: |
| 16 | * - drivers/base/intf.c |
| 17 | * - Documentation/driver-model/interface.txt |
| 18 | */ |
